CodeMaster 2025-04-13 21:30 采纳率: 98.3%
浏览 48

如何查看MySQL数据库的安装路径?

在使用MySQL时,有时需要确定其安装路径以进行配置或维护。如何查看MySQL数据库的安装路径呢?以下是常见方法: 1. **通过命令行查询**:登录MySQL后执行 `SELECT @@basedir;` 可获取基础安装目录;执行 `SELECT @@datadir;` 获取数据存储路径。 2. **检查服务配置**:在Windows中,通过服务管理器找到MySQL服务,右键属性查看“可执行路径”。Linux下可通过 `which mysql` 或 `whereis mysql` 定位二进制文件路径。 3. **查看配置文件**:通常配置文件(如my.ini或my.cnf)会包含安装和数据路径信息。默认位置可能为 `/etc/mysql/my.cnf` 或安装目录下的 `my.ini`。 如果上述方法均不可用,尝试搜索系统中的MySQL相关文件夹,结合安装记录确认具体路径。
  • 写回答

1条回答 默认 最新

  • 桃子胖 2025-04-13 21:30
    关注

    1. 初步了解:MySQL安装路径的重要性

    在数据库管理中,确定MySQL的安装路径是进行配置和维护的关键步骤。无论是调整性能参数、备份数据还是排查问题,都需要准确知道MySQL的安装位置。

    对于初学者来说,可以通过以下简单方法快速定位:

    • 命令行查询:登录MySQL后执行 `SELECT @@basedir;` 获取基础安装目录;执行 `SELECT @@datadir;` 获取数据存储路径。
    • 服务配置检查:在Windows系统中,通过服务管理器找到MySQL服务,右键属性查看“可执行路径”。

    2. 进阶分析:多平台下的路径定位技巧

    不同的操作系统对MySQL的安装路径有不同的默认设置。以下是针对Linux和Windows的具体操作方法:

    2.1 Linux环境下的路径查找

    Linux下可通过以下命令定位MySQL的二进制文件路径:

    which mysql
    whereis mysql
    

    这些命令可以帮助你找到MySQL客户端或服务器的可执行文件所在位置。

    2.2 Windows环境下的路径查找

    在Windows中,除了通过服务管理器查看外,还可以利用安装记录或搜索功能来定位MySQL的安装目录。

    方法描述
    服务管理器打开“服务”窗口,找到MySQL服务,右键属性查看“可执行路径”。
    安装记录回顾安装过程中的路径选择,通常为C:\Program Files\MySQL。

    3. 高级探索:配置文件解析

    MySQL的配置文件(如my.ini或my.cnf)通常包含详细的路径信息。这些文件可能位于以下位置:

    • Linux:`/etc/mysql/my.cnf` 或 `/etc/my.cnf`
    • Windows:安装目录下的 `my.ini`

    配置文件不仅定义了数据存储路径,还可能包含插件、日志等其他重要信息。

    4. 最终手段:全局搜索与路径确认

    如果以上方法均不可用,可以尝试以下步骤:

    1. 使用文件搜索工具(如Everything或find命令)查找MySQL相关文件夹。
    2. 结合安装记录或系统日志,进一步确认具体路径。

    以下是基于流程图的路径查找逻辑:

    graph TD; A[开始] --> B{是否能登录MySQL?}; B --是--> C[执行SELECT @@basedir 和 SELECT @@datadir]; B --否--> D{是否为Windows?}; D --是--> E[检查服务管理器]; D --否--> F[使用which或whereis命令]; C --> G{是否明确路径?}; G --否--> H[检查配置文件]; H --> I[结束];
    评论

报告相同问题?

问题事件

  • 创建了问题 4月13日